Typically, clients utilize Assembly Planner to import the engineering bill of materials (eBOM) directly from their product data management (PDM) or product lifecycle management (PLM) systems, along with an associated Engineering Change Order that highlights critical information regarding the modification. Following this, Assembly Planner enables manufacturing engineers to compare the eBOM with any pre-existing manufacturing bill of materials (mBOM) to identify necessary adjustments to the processes, shop floor instructions, tooling, and logistics. These modifications frequently occur within the framework of one or several Manufacturing Change Orders (MCO), which specify details such as Effective Date, Series, or Serial numbers relevant to the changes being implemented. Once the mBOM and Bill of Process (BOP) data have been thoroughly updated and verified in Assembly Planner, this finalized information is then disseminated to the ERP, logistics, and the Shop Floor MES/Andon systems.
